The Story

WeWork Inc. is an American company headquartered in New York City that provides coworking spaces, including physical and virtual shared spaces, in approximately 600 buildings in 125 cities. WeWork was founded in 2010 by Adam Neumann and Miguel McKelvey. Over the following 10 years, the company raised $12.8 billion in financing at valuations as high as $47 billion, mostly from the SoftBank Vision Fund, led by Masayoshi Son. In September 2019, the company filed documentation to become a public company and revealed issues with corporate governance.

WeWork co-founder Miguel McKelvey dispenses unfiltered advice to three founders at growth plateaus. A high-end pants maker learns to embed her "why" everywhere, a grief care business discovers AI-optimized content could be its new growth engine, and a history merch brand $750K strong realizes polished Instagram is losing to raw storytelling. Miguel's prescription: tell your story so relentlessly that customers can't forget you exist.
